MgO nanoparticles (NPs) and Gr/MgO nanocomposite (NC) have been synthesized by hydrothermal route. X-ray diffraction (XRD) analysis confirmed the crystalline cubic phase of MgO and Gr/MgO NC. Raman spectroscopy was used to study the defects in the NCs. Electron microscopy study display spherical NPs of MgO on graphene sheets. UV-visible spectroscopy shows a red shift in the absorption band and a significant reduction in the bandgap for Gr/MgO NC. The improvements in dielectric properties of NC can be ascribed to interfacial polarization between rGO and MgO. The rGO in the NCs supports the electron transfer and improves the electrical conductivity. (C) 2019 Elsevier B.V. All rights reserved.
